5. Electrical Wiring, Conduit, and Connections Relating to
Internal Communications Systems (Property Unit 3090)
The conduit, wiring, and electrical connections in Property
Unit 3090 are required for the use and operation of the
hospitals' internal communications systems (i.e., the nurse call
systems, the intercommunications systems, the dictation systems,
and the music and paging systems).12 Petitioners' use of the
conduit, floor boxes, and outlet jacks is due in part to local
building codes. Those items are used only and directly with the
equipment comprising those systems. The items in issue are
attached to the walls, floors, and ceilings of petitioners'
hospitals and are located between the secondary electrical
distribution systems and the particular items of equipment to
which they relate. The items are specifically for use with the
hospitals' internal communication systems.
6. Carpeting (Property Unit 2140)
The carpeting in Property Unit 2140 is the carpeting that
was originally placed in petitioners' hospital facilities during
construction. The carpeting is custom fit to the area in which
it is laid, and is installed over the sealed concrete floor using
adhesives. The adhesives prevent the carpeting from slipping or
skidding while it covers the floors of the hospitals.
12 The parties agree that the machinery and equipment to which
the items in Property Unit 3090 relate are properly depreciable
over 5-year periods.
